+ // The Microsoft mangler may insert a special character in the beginning to
+ // prevent further mangling. We can strip that for display purposes.
+ if (Buf[0] == '\x01') {
+ Buf.erase(0, 1);
+ }
It’s not clear to me, is this character part of the final mangled name or not ?
If this is part of the actual mangled name shouldn’t we keep it to be correct
and let the display printer handle it (e.g. by displaying it as “\x01” or
something) ?
